SF_6-N_2中粒子动力学特性的蒙特卡罗仿真

摘    要:为了模拟SF6-N2混合气体的汤逊脉冲实验过程,求出不同状态下混合气体的电子能量分布特性,在电场强度与气体分子密度之比为(250~450)Td范围内,采用蒙特卡罗法仿真了SF6-N2混合气体的电子雪崩发展过程.求出了电子能量分布随电场强度与气体分子密度之比的变化规律、有效电离系数及临界耐电强度随SF6分压比变化的规律,且与实验结果作了比较和分析.结果表明,混合气体临界击穿场强Eb随着SF6分压比的增加而提高,与实验结果比较,有很好的一致性.

Monte Carlo Simulating on Particle Dynamics of SF6-N2 Mixtures

Abstract:To simulate the experiments of the pulsed Townsend in the SF6-N2 gas mixtures and obtain the distributions of the electronic energies in different states,the development of the electron avalanche in SF6-N2 gas mixtures is traced using the Monte Carlo simulation for the ratio of electric field to gas density(250 ~ 450) Td.The effective ionization coefficients,the distributions of the electronic energies and critical electric field of gas mixtures are directly obtained from the simulation,and the results obtained are compared with the experiment data,the results show that breakdown field strength increases with SF6 ratio increasing gas which accords well with the experiment data.
